After much talk and anticipation, Pusha T's It’s Almost Dry album is here.

Ye West is featured on two of the tracks, one of them being Dreamin Of The Past, which he also produced.

On the cut, the Chicago artist reveals that he almost bought the house seen on The Fresh Prince of Bel-Air but there was something about it that he didn't like.

“I used to watch the Fresh Prince and pray the house would be mine / Could have bought it but I ain’t like the way the kitchen designed,”rapped Ye.

He addressed co-parenting with his ex Kim Kardashian as well, saying the family is worse off since he moved out.

“Born in the manger, the son of a stranger / When daddy’s not home, the family’s in danger,”spit Ye.
